2009 Buell 1125 CR, A fearsome blend of superbike performance, sinister styling and wicked attitude.ENGINE Helicon, 4-stroke, 72 V-twin, DOHC, 4-valves per cylinder, finger follower design and shimming HORSEPOWER 146 hp @ 9,800 rpm DISPLACEMENT 68.7 ci (1,125 cc) BORE X STROKE 4.055 x 2.658 in. (103 x 67.5 mm) TORQUE 82 ft. lbs. (111 Nm) @ 8,000 rpm COMPRESSION RATIO 12.3:1 FUEL SYSTEM Dual 61 mm down-draft throttle bodies, DDFI III fuel injection FUEL CAPACITY 5.3 gal. (20.1 l) with 0.8 gal. (3 l) reserve STARTING 900W electric with 1-way clutch CLUTCH Wet, multi-plate, Hydraulic Vacuum Assist (HVA) slipper-action clutch, hydraulic clutch lever effort COOLING Liquid EXHAUST Tuned, tri-pass resonance chamber with integral helmholtz tuning and mass-centralized mounting OIL CAPACITY 2.7 qt. (2.6 l)

Erik Buell Racing-Developed 2014 Hero Karizma ZMR and Karizma R Revealed

Mon, 30 Sep 2013

Hero Motocorp has updated its Karizma ZMR and Karizma R for 2014, the first products from the Indian manufacturer developed with Erik Buell Racing. The two companies signed a development deal last February before the relationship deepened with Hero buying 49.2% of EBR a few months later. The fully-faired Karizma ZMR and the partially-faired R version were revealed at an event last week in Macau.

Harley’s Ed Krawiec is 2011 NHRA Pro Stock Motorcycle Champ

Mon, 14 Nov 2011

Harley-Davidson Screamin’ Eagle/Vance & Hines rider Ed Krawiec is the 2011 NHRA Pro Stock Motorcycle world champion. Krawiec clinched the title with a second-round win at the Automobile Club of Southern California NHRA Finals at Auto Club Raceway that eliminated Lucas Oil Buell rider Hector Arana Jr., the only rider in the field with a chance to overtake Krawiec for the championship. Krawiec advanced to the final round and lost to his Harley-Davidson Screamin’ Eagle/Vance & Hines teammate Andrew Hines, who finished the season third in points. What’s next for Polaris?

Wed, 20 May 2009

Polaris Industries, the parent company of Victory Motorcycles, announced this week it will form a new on-road vehicle division. The official announcement says the new division “maximizes cohesive and strategic growth for Victory Motorcycles and other on-road products and brands”. Which begs the question: what other on-road products and brands?
